Seems Vortex auto-initiates a full purge when I make certain changes; why and how to shut off automatic purging?

This is because you have two or more mods of different mod types (i.e. what folder they deploy to) that have conflicting files.  For Skyrim (and other Bethesda games) this is usually a mod overwriting Script Extender scripts, or if you have an ENB a mod like PG Patcher's output overwriting the dynamic cubemap.  The offending mods will have an exclamation point next to the other symbol in the Dependencies column in the Mods tab - you might have to enable the Dependencies column to see it, I think it's disabled by default.

There are a few other threads about this if you need more information.

 

Edit: To resolve this, delete/merge the file(s) that are conflicting.
